Transaction 243e0f2b1efffa3c81260757b5ea7ad66728220eb765c811eca25979950eaef3
1 Input
1 Output
-
243e0f2b1efffa3c81260757b5ea7ad66728220eb765c811eca25979950eaef3:0
- value
- 2287146
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 12b5d4ba1816a7b62cd09f81774d1c1bc5b29c9b OP_EQUALVERIFY OP_CHECKSIG
- address
- 12hvzHp4bUz3ob7Mud8Q24tNs9Q9Hqk4uM